Neon Rush Splitz Slot: Overview
Neon Rush Splitz is the second release from Swedish studio Yggdrasil Gaming to use their proprietary Splitz mechanic. The first, Temple Stacks, took players on an exotic jungle adventure, whereas Neon Rush leans into a retro-punk, futuristic 80s vibe. It’s a style that feels simultaneously classic and cutting-edge, and it keeps gaining more entries.
Neon Rush Splitz stands out as one of the stronger examples of the theme and a solid display of Yggdrasil’s design skills, even if some players may be put off by the more minimal symbol selection. Everything has been put together with clear intent, with each element working neatly alongside the others, and the underlying figures are tempting enough to keep the reels turning.
First impressions are immediately favorable thanks to the polished presentation. If you’re playing on mobile, landscape mode is the way to go for the full experience. In that view, you’ll see a Tron-inspired setting, with the 5×3 grid sliding forward toward distant skyscrapers. Off to the side, a motorcyclist keeps you company, occasionally swapping sides and reacting to your wins.
The visuals are backed by equally strong audio, delivering a top-tier Synthwave soundtrack that still feels fresh. Spin and win sound effects are also spot-on. Yggdrasil’s audio-visual work is usually reliable, but Neon Rush Splitz pushes it further. If you like this aesthetic, it’s pure retro-electro bliss.
Bet options are somewhat limited, likely to keep risk in check given the Ultra Jackpot potential. Wagers begin at 10 p/c and go up to $/€40 per spin. The rest of the stats are appealing too, including an RTP of 96.03%, high volatility, and a hit rate a little better than 1 in 5. The theme may be modern, but the gameplay rules are easy to follow.
The aim is to hit winning combinations of three or more matching symbols. There are only 10 paylines to land them on, though the Splitz mechanic adds a distinctive layer. When Splitz symbols appear, they split into 1-5 regular symbols—fewer than Temple Stacks, which could go up to 9. Any Splitz symbols that land on the same spin will reveal the same symbol, and in the base game that reveal can be any other symbol available.
All symbols are custom-designed and capture the game’s clean, futuristic simplicity. The set is small, with lower-value shapes like a triangle, diamond, and hexagon. The two premium symbols are a pink shard and a green shard—landing 5 premiums across a full payline pays 2 times the stake, but the Splitz feature allows combinations of up to 15 of a kind, paying 500 times the stake. Finally, there’s the wild, which only shows up when uncovered by a Splitz symbol. Each Splitz can reveal up to 5, and wilds substitute for any other paying symbol.
Neon Rush Splitz Slot: Features

The feature set is straightforward, focusing on free spins and jackpots. To take a shot at the biggest prizes, players must uncover Jackpot symbols. These are revealed by Splitz symbols, each of which can contain up to 5 jackpot symbols. Every time a Jackpot Symbol is revealed, it advances the jackpot meter as follows :
- 5 Jackpot Symbols results in the Rush Jackpot and 5x the bet.
- 6 Jackpot Symbols results in the Neon Jackpot and 20x the bet.
- 7 Jackpot Symbols results in the Hyper Jackpot and 50x the bet.
- 8 Jackpot Symbols results in the Mega Jackpot and 100x the bet.
- 9 Jackpot Symbols results in the Superior Jackpot and 500x the bet.
- 10 Jackpot Symbols results in the Ultra Jackpot and 25,000x the bet.
Another way to boost your chances at jackpots and increase overall returns is the Free Spins feature. It can be a bit challenging to trigger, thanks to the low bonus frequency and volatility, which likely balances out the huge jackpot upside. To activate it, land 3, 4, or 5 scatter symbols to receive 10, 20, or 30 free spins respectively. In the free spins round, Splitz symbols can reveal only wilds or jackpot symbols.
Neon Rush Splitz Slot: Verdict
Neon Rush Splitz is an impressively crafted slot from top to bottom. The visuals and audio blend smoothly to build a deeply immersive futuristic mood. Subtle background motion keeps the scene lively, and the biker companion adds personality so it never feels like you’re spinning in isolation. If this kind of slot is your thing, Neon Rush Splitz feels like cruising a purple Trans am with an F-16 HUD straight into deep space, or plugging directly into Tron. It’s tailor-made for the Mr Robot, Stranger Things, Bladerunner-style dystopian future crowd.
The gameplay holds up just as well. The Splitz mechanic feels more refined here and can create genuinely exciting swings. One moment you might be waiting on a Splitz reveal to complete a shard line, and instead it opens into a spread of wilds that connects far more paylines than expected—those turns can be especially satisfying.
Splitz symbols become even more valuable in free spins, where they can only grant wilds or jackpot symbols. Neon Rush would remain highly playable even without the jackpot element, but the possibility of landing wins above 25,000 times your stake undeniably raises the excitement. It’s particularly effective when Splitz symbols start unveiling jackpot symbols gradually, building suspense with each reveal.
Overall, Yggdrasil has delivered a standout entry in the genre with Neon Rush, and it’s a must for fans of this aesthetic. If that’s you, settle in and enjoy the atmosphere and strong mechanics. And even if it isn’t, Neon Rush Splitz still offers solid, straightforward gameplay plus jackpots that can appeal to plenty of different players.
